Used in Paint Industry:
Lead succinate is used as a stabilizer and pigment for enhancing the properties and appearance of paint products. Its presence helps in improving the durability and color retention of the paint, making it a preferred choice in certain applications.
Used in Ceramics Industry:
In the ceramics industry, lead succinate is employed as a stabilizer to improve the physical and chemical properties of ceramic materials. It contributes to the strength, stability, and overall quality of the final ceramic products.
However, due to the highly toxic nature of lead succinate, its use in consumer products has been regulated in many countries. Ingestion or inhalation of lead succinate can lead to severe health issues, including abdominal pain, nausea, vomiting, and in extreme cases, organ damage or even death. As a result, efforts are being made to minimize exposure to lead succinate and protect public health.
Check Digit Verification of cas no
The CAS Registry Mumber 1191-18-0 includes 7 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 4 digits, 1,1,9 and 1 respectively; the second part has 2 digits, 1 and 8 respectively.
Calculate Digit Verification of CAS Registry Number 1191-18:
(6*1)+(5*1)+(4*9)+(3*1)+(2*1)+(1*8)=60
60 % 10 = 0
So 1191-18-0 is a valid CAS Registry Number.

Synthesis and characterisation of polymeric and oligomeric lead(II) carboxylates
Foreman, Mark R.St.J.,John Plater,Skakle, Janet M.S.
, p. 1897 - 1903 (2007/10/03)
The hydrothermal reactions of lead(II) acetate with carboxylic acids gave solids of composition [Pb(C4H4O4)] 1 (C4H4O4 = succinate); [Pb6O2(C14H9O3)8 ] 2 (C14H9O3 = benzoylbenzoate), [Pb(C8H4NO4)2(H2O)] 4 (C8H4NO4 = 2-nitrobenzoate) and [Pb(C8H3N2O6)2(H2 O)] 5 (C8H3N2O6 = 3,5-dinitrobenzoate). The reaction of lead monoxide with trichloroacetic acid in hot wet toluene followed by filtration and cooling gave a solid of composition [Pb3(C2Cl3O2)6(H2 O)3] 3. The compounds were characterised by X-ray single crystal structure determinations. Compounds 1, 3, 4 and 5 are polymeric whereas 2 is monomeric. The lead co-ordination number ranges from 5 to 8. Compound 2 is a novel hexanuclear lead(II) distorted octahedron containing two bridging oxide ligands.
